Had a strange experience when calling Jet’s pizza to use a groupon deal. When we ordered we mentioned that we had a deal to for $ 10 off $ 20. The pizza price online was $ 20. After we placed the order they the person on the phone mentioned that we would owe $ 6. We were confused since we had a $ 20 deal from groupon and should only owe tax which shouldn’t be $ 6. He then mentioned that the pizza becomes more expensive since we are using a groupon deal(Even though the website states $ 20 as the standard price) and therefore it is a $ 23 pizza plus tax which makes it close to $ 6. We were off put by their deceptive practices and ordered pizza at the many other places nearby that have pizza. This is disappointing as I really wanted to give Jet’s Pizza a try but just couldn’t deal with deceptive business practices.

My favorite«quick pizza» in Georgia. Hell, it’s my favorite quick pizza anywhere. I’ve lived in many other places, and in the north(like Michigan and Ohio) Jet’s is THE pizza go-to. I can’t stress this enough, and hope it catches fire in Georgia so my East Cobb location can start catering to my late night needs. Currently they close before 10pm, and if you’re like me on a Friday night your pizza engine doesn’t rev until midnight. Let’s start with the basics: thin crust is exceptionally good. Want a little more chew? Go with the 8-corner — Sicilian style where each slice gets an edge, and its got a chewy/crunchy texture that makes you wonder why it doesn’t come in a 72-corner option. Always, always Turbo Crust. If you don’t like butter/garlic/parmesan — why the hell are you trying to enjoy pizza. Pro tip: All of the breadstick options are the same price. Garlic parm sticks? $ 5.99. Mozzarella sticks? $ 5.99. Triple cheese turbo explosion mind bender sticks? $ 5.99. See where I’m headed now? Don’t be a sucker.
